Stingers live in water environments such as [[Inside Jabu-Jabu's Belly]] and the [[Water Temple (Ocarina of Time)|Water Temple]]. They prefer to remain swimming underwater until [[Link]] gets near, although they can also be found diving out from underneath the floor, with only their upper fin visible when inside of it. On most occasions, they appear in groups.

Once a threat approaches, they fly out of the water and circle around in the air, eventually diving toward their prey. [[Link]] can hit them with his sword when they dive at him, or he can attack them with ranged weapons such as the [[Slingshot]], [[Boomerang]], [[Hookshot]], or [[Fairy Bow]]. [[Deku Nut]]s are useful to stun them if they get too close.
